It's not the best ever, but both teams can feel like they won substantially.
Minkah looks like a major piece to upgrade the Steelers secondary for a long time. The Steelers got a guy at a position of major need that they never would have scored with their own pick.
The Dolphins are stockpiling, and they got a major asset. They can remake their team these next two years, and have so many holes they need flexibility.
I like the trade for the Steelers. I like it for the Dolphins.
